Eduardo S9 months ago

Hi.

First of all, you need to check connection of that computed attributes with the user that doesn't shows it.

Second, when a computed attribute is connected to a device, the result of that computation is added in the data of that device positions. So, if a computed attribute is really connected to a device nd calculations are correct, then all users that are connected to that device (look here, i said device, even if the user is not connected to that attribute) should see compute result. The connection of a computed attribute with an account is just to edit it or manage it. But since computed attribute is added to a device, computed data is added to every position received of that device.

So, if when you say "I am not able to see the Computed Attributed I have created on a device." you mean that you cannot see the computed attribute in your account, but you can see the result of computation, then you should look at attribute connection with that account.

If you mean that device doesn't show computed attribute result in their position attributes, then first you should ensure your account is connected with the computed attribute in question. After that, you need to do some tests to guarantee calculation is being done correctly.

Eduardo S7 months ago

@gaskoo

If you want to hide io attributes you can do it on two ways :
First one is creating null computed attribute for io you want to hide.

Second one is to set lower priority to that attribute in Teltonika configuration. You must investigate and identify which parameter is being sent as io#, and set lower priority according to parameter list of your Teltonika model.
